Back End Developer

April 7, 2025
Application ends: April 3, 2026
Apply Now

Job Description

A software development Saudi Company is looking for a professional Back End Programmer.

Bachelor’s degree in computer science or related field.

Stay updated with emerging technologies and industry trends to continuously improve existing systems and adopt best practices.
Write clean, maintainable, and well-documented code to facilitate future updates and collaboration within the development team.
Implement security protocols and data protection measures to safeguard sensitive information and maintain compliance with industry standards.
Optimize database queries and perform data modeling to ensure high performance and scalability of applications under heavy load.
Design and implement robust APIs to ensure seamless communication between the front-end and back-end systems, enhancing user experience.
Collaborate closely with front-end developers to integrate user-facing elements with server-side logic, ensuring cohesive functionality.
Conduct thorough testing and debugging of applications to identify and resolve issues before deployment, ensuring a smooth user experience.
Assist in the deployment of applications on cloud platforms, ensuring proper configuration and performance monitoring.
Ability to deliver tasks on time.
More than 4 years of experience at mobile development.
Experience with Laravel Framework.
In depth understanding of Object-Oriented Programming (OOP).
Experience in SQL and MySQL database systems and Firebase
Experience in development of Android/iOS applications and have deployed them on Google Play/App Store.
Experience working with SVN version control system

Desired Candidate Profile

Egyptian, Indian, Saudi Arabian, Bangladeshi

Bachelors in Computer Application(Computers), Bachelor of Technology/Engineering(Computers)

Male

Bachelor’s degree in Computer Science or a related field, providing a solid foundation in programming and software development principles.
Experience with relational and NoSQL databases, such as MySQL, PostgreSQL, or MongoDB, to manage and manipulate data efficiently.
Familiarity with RESTful services and API design principles, enabling the creation of scalable and maintainable applications.
Strong problem-solving skills, with the ability to troubleshoot and resolve issues quickly and effectively.
Ability to work independently as well as part of a team, showcasing adaptability in various working environments.